RILL EROSION PROCESS ON STEEP SLOPE LAND OF THE LOESS PLATEAU
ZHENG Fenli and TANG Keli.RILL EROSION PROCESS ON STEEP SLOPE LAND OF THE LOESS PLATEAU[J].International Journal of Sediment Research,1997(1).

Abstract:Rill erosion processes and principle of preventing rill erosion of different applied measures are studied by rainfall simulation and field investigation. Research results show that rill erosion processes can be schematically divided into five stages, that is, concentrated flow forming process; little waterfalls in the concentrated flow forming Process; little waterfalls developing into rill head cut process; rill head cuts developing to form discontinuous rill process and discontinuous rills connecting to form continuous rill process. Rill head cuts backward erosion, rill wall collapsing and runoff washing rill bed are the main patterns of rill development. The relevant equation between critical runoff volume of occurring rill erosion and slope degree can be expressed as follows: Q = 76. 10 - 2. 10J. And relevant equation between critical slope length of occurrence Of rill erosion and slope degree is parabolic with a minimum-value. In addition, influence of rill erosion development on slope runoff and soil erosion, benefits and principle of reducing rill erosion amount of mulch, non-tillage system and remained residue, strip alternation of grass and crop, horizontal ditch are also studied.
